Atlus, XSEED, Humble, and more to feature at this year's PC Gaming Show
Despite all the struggles that 2020 has brought, the show must go on, at least, for the PC Gaming Show. The recently-delayed event has just revealed its developer and publisher lineup for the 2020 PC Gaming Show, giving a tantalizing glimpse at what fans can expect to see. Notably, Atlus and SEGA will be showing games, alongside XSEED, Humble, 2K, Amazon, DONTNOD, and more. Over 50 games will be revealed during the show, which will take place digitally on June 13th at 11 am PDT.
